Giants signed WR Malik Nabers to a four-year contract.

Nabers joins a wide receiver room that’s arguably the worst in the league. Considered by some to be the best receiver in this year’s rookie class, Nabers has a chance to step into a significant target share right off the bat as he and quarterback Daniel Jones look to turn around a passing attack that ranked 31st in passing yards per game (169.8) and threw for the fourth-fewest touchdown passes (15) on the year. Nabers caught 89 passes for 1,569 yards and 14 touchdowns during his final year at LSU and had two 1,000-yard seasons in his three-year career.
